Memo to Sales Leads — Q2 Cash-Flow Forecast

Team, quick heads-up on the Q2 numbers. Collections on the Pellward accounts came in slower than hoped, so operating cash looks tighter through May before the Quintrell renewals land in June. Nothing alarming, but please chase open invoices and flag anything wobbly to Dara's team early. We're holding discretionary spend flat until mid-quarter. Keep this between us and your deputies for now. The fuller picture on where we're steering the business sits just below.

management briefing: The pricing group signed off on a budget of $378.8 million for Project Kasael.

Runbook — Quillbarn scanner integration. If scans stop posting, check the Redloft bridge first: restart its daemon, confirm the USB-HID handoff, then replay the buffered scan queue. Reviewer note: do not merge changes to the decode loop without running the Quillbarn conformance suite. Buffered events older than 15 minutes are dropped by design. The last verified bridge build is noted below.

build token for hafop-fawif: htk31_9758d5e565aa3b14f55d629377373c4

FAQ: What if I'm locked out of the Hueledger audit workspace?

Contractors running the color-contrast audit for the Marrowgate redesign sometimes lose access after the weekly permission sweep. Don't create a new account; that breaks audit attribution. Instead, open the Hueledger recovery prompt, confirm your assigned component list, and enter the team passphrase printed directly beneath this answer.

unlock words, bagug-kadup: wenath-zorael

**TICKET-2291: WebSocket compression eating CPU on Pondside relay**

Enabling permessage-deflate cut bandwidth ~60% but CPU on the relay nodes jumped noticeably during peak. Proposal for sync: compress only messages over 1KB and skip the chatty heartbeats. Repro and flamegraphs attached. The build I profiled against is noted below.

build token for bafop-fahag: htk31_54fa17da51a5745f4aae16134587efa